I AM Love
Love is mighty.
A drop of it could quench deserts.
A breath of it could clear mountains.
A glimpse of it could illumine caverns.
Yet is love gentle.
I touch it and am not inflamed.
I taste it and am not sickened.
I behold it and am no longer blind.
I’m weak
When I’m afraid.
I’m small
When I’m angry.
I’m hollow
When I’m arrogant.
I AM Mighty
When I Love.
